- Opioid tolerance:
- Common in patients receiving long-term opioid therapy
- Not the same as addiction
- May require careful medication administration
- Addiction to opioids:
- Rare
- Should not be the focus of pain management efforts
- Importance of proper pain assessment and management:
- Consider both risks and benefits of using opioids
- Have open communication with patient about pain management plan
- Be aware of potential signs of opioid abuse or misuse
- Consider a combination of pharmacological and non-pharmacological approaches
- Ongoing assessment and communication with patient
- Proper management of pain and opioid use can help ensure best possible outcomes for patient
